- A song of prayer by Evangelist (Blackman) Akeeb Kareem with the CCC Olorunshogo Choir (Ibadan 199X).
Baba mi lo loko ti n wa 'ko re,
So mo pe mo wa ninu oko
Ma se jeje ma wa mi lo (Baba mi)
Ma se je k'oko yi wo igbo (Baba mi)
Ma se je k'oko yi danu (Baba mi)
Si mi dele oloko yi o (Baba mi)
Ma je k'aye bere pe nibo l'Olorun mi wa
Ma je k'ota bere pe nibo ni Jesu mi wa
Ma je k'aye bere pe nibo l'Olorun mi wa
Ma je k'ota bere pe nibo ni Kristi mi wa
Won lo ti lo lati esin
O l'ohun wa Jesu lo
Ki lo ri mubo nibe
Baba ma se temi beyen
